  • [SOLVED] Gnome 3 : Nautilus won't start from other application

    Hi everyone!
    Ok I search everywhere and I found nothing. I have this problem for a long time for now. My interface is in french so I'll try to translate the message but they could be differente in an english gnome.
    I can start nautilus directly from the console or from the menu, no problem. But when I connect a usb drive or any external drive it pop me : "Impossible to open a folder for 'usbName'. No application are register to execute this file".
    Another exemple is when a download a file from internet and then from the browser I click "open the containing folder" it do nothing.
    If a open Baobab and I right click a folder and "open folder" it pop me : "Impossible to open the folder 'folderName'. No viewer are install"
    So well.... I really don't know what to do... Maybe it is in a kind of default application editor but well.. I find something that was kind of this but there was no option for the default system explorer.
    Help me please!!
    Thank you ! Hope someone know what to do! :-(
    Last edited by mooviies (2011-07-30 02:13:16)

    mooviies wrote:
    Hi everyone!
    I can start nautilus directly from the console or from the menu, no problem. But when I connect a usb drive or any external drive it pop me : "Impossible to open a folder for 'usbName'. No application are register to execute this file".
    Another exemple is when a download a file from internet and then from the browser I click "open the containing folder" it do nothing.
    If a open Baobab and I right click a folder and "open folder" it pop me : "Impossible to open the folder 'folderName'. No viewer are install"
    So well.... I really don't know what to do... Maybe it is in a kind of default application editor but well.. I find something that was kind of this but there was no option for the default system explorer.
    right-click on a file / file-type that has no registered application, then click 'properties' and then navigate to the 'open with' tab ~ if there are no applications listed then click 'show other applications'... after that find the proper application to open a given file, then click 'set as default'.
    this should solve your problem. The only one i am not sure about is the USB thing, but the rest are easily solved. Gnome by default will not automatically associate all mime-types to applications. you need to do some of this yourself.
    for example; in order for .html files to open in gedit by default, I first had to associate .html to gedit, and 'set as default' ~ otherwise, all html (local files) automatically would open in Firefox.

  • [Solved] Thunderbird (64-bit) won't start

    It gives the following error
    $ /opt/thunderbird/thunderbird
    /opt/thunderbird/thunderbird-bin: error while loading shared libraries: libdbus-glib-1.so.2: cannot open shared object file: No such file or directory
    But it does exist
    $ locate libdbus-glib-1.so.2
    /usr/lib/libdbus-glib-1.so.2
    /usr/lib/libdbus-glib-1.so.2.1.0
    Following packages are installed
    $ pacman -Ss lib32 | grep glib
    multilib/lib32-glib 1.2.10-11 [0.11 MB] [installed]
    multilib/lib32-glib2 2.26.1-2 [1.26 MB] [installed]
    multilib/lib32-glibc 2.13-1 [2.43 MB] [installed]
    $ pacman -Ss lib32 | grep dbus
    multilib/lib32-dbus-core 1.4.0-2 [0.09 MB] [installed]
    Last edited by milomak (2011-02-24 19:51:25)

    wonder wrote:you need lib32-dbus-glib and not lib32-glib or lib32-glib2
